Hi guys, running a 12ht motor currently at stock 8psi of boost. I am hoping to up the boost to 13-15psi (hoping to get a high flowed turbo soon.)
My question is, would you bother running an intercooler for 13-15psi? I personally think i should then a couple of people told me they wouldn't bother then others said yes it's a must. Thanks
 
Yep, Lower Egt's, cooler charge temperatures means more HP. No matter the size of the cooler. Anything is better than nothing.
 
just don’t go too big on the piping if you go a/a intercooler or it might accentuate turbo lag. it’s just more volume you need to pressurize. but realistically any time you want to increase fuel an intercooler is good. it won’t harm anything for sure.
 
I just installed a large intercooler on my 1HDT with a stock turbo. My butt-o-meter says that it is a worthwhile addition to the truck. The truck is not a rocket anyways, but I really can't see that it creates a noticeable lag.
